Chapter 30 Apology
Qian Duoduo was delighted. He hadn't been this happy in years. He excitedly pulled Huo Yuhao up, shouting, "Great! Great! From today on, I'll have a son too."

Xian Lin'er was also very happy. They had never had children, and she herself didn't know when she would be able to completely let go of the past and accept Qian Duoduo. Today, the two of them could acknowledge Huo Yuhao as their adopted son, which could at least temporarily bridge the subtle gap between them.

Xian Lin'er saw Qian Duoduo's expression and felt relieved. Qian Duoduo had been with her for so many years without saying anything.
If recognizing Huo Yuhao today can make up for her guilt, Xian Lin'er actually knows very well that recognizing Huo Yuhao is more about her own desire to have a child. But she still
Xian Lin'er knew that after today, she owed him even more.
"Yuhao, come home and have dinner with us tonight. Teacher Mom will cook for us."

Huo Yuhao's mood was very complicated at this moment. At this moment, he had parents again, but he also knew that the essence of this relationship was a two-way reliance, not a connection based on blood.

But so what? When he thought of his wild father and compared the two, he actually wanted to cry, but he held it back.

He has been an orphan since his mother died. Now he is really happy to have a place that can be called home again, even if this feeling is not so pure.
Huo Yuhao's eyes were red. He looked at Xian Lin'er, then at Qian Duoduo, and nodded gently, saying, "I'll listen to my parents."

Xian Lin'er couldn't help but hug Huo Yuhao in her arms, tears flickering in her eyes.

"Good boy. Good boy."

Qian Duoduo looked at the scene in front of him with satisfaction, and he felt that this life was worth it.

At this moment, the doorbell of the ninth test area rang.

Xian Lin'er let go of Huo Yuhao, straightened her posture slightly, and nodded slightly to Qian Duoduo.

Qian Duoduo understood what he meant and walked to the gate, pressed the switch, and a middle-aged man about 1.8 meters tall walked in.

The middle-aged man had very broad shoulders and was only wearing simple cloth clothes. His sturdy figure was faintly visible, and he gave people a feeling of being as steady as a mountain when he stood there.

The middle-aged man bowed slightly and said, "Fan Yu greets the two deans."

Huo Yuhao looked at the arrival of this person thoughtfully. He vaguely guessed that it was related to him, but he was not sure what the other party's attitude was.

Xian Lin'er and Qian Duoduo looked at Fan Yu in confusion. They didn't know what Fan Yu was doing here at this time.

Fan Yu was quite frank. He bowed deeply to the two deans, then explained his purpose under the puzzled gazes of Xian Lin'er and Qian Duoduo, "Zhou Yi has caused me trouble again. It's a bit of a fuss, and it's brought shame to Shrek. I've come here to apologize to the two deans."

Fan Yu glanced calmly at Huo Yuhao as he spoke. This action clearly caught the attention of the two deans, who began to speculate. Qian Duoduo asked in a deep voice, "Fan Yu, tell me the whole story from beginning to end." Fan Yu nodded and said, "Zhou Yi's teaching methods have always been controversial. Although I've always covered up for her, I never imagined she would go so far this time. This morning, right after school started, she made the entire class run a hundred laps around the square, claiming there hadn't been a fight. She even threatened to expel any students who disobeyed her. Later, she got into an argument with a classmate, and Zhou Yi couldn't help but start a fight, but she didn't do anything to the other person. Du Weilun stepped in to control the situation, preventing it from getting out of hand."

"I was wrong about this."

Xian Lin'er frowned and said, "That's indeed excessive. The Spirit Department should have already issued a disciplinary action this time, right? Let's handle this matter impartially. Go back and have your Zhou Yi reflect on this matter! This matter will undoubtedly spread to the various forces behind them through the new students. Suspension is already the minimum punishment. Let her fend for herself."

Qian Duoduo hadn't forgotten the look Fan Yu had given Huo Yuhao. He asked, somewhat puzzled, "Fan Yu, did you just say that Zhou Yi had an argument with a student? They fought but didn't do anything to the other person? What's the name of this freak freshman?"

Fan Yu did not say anything, but looked straight at Huo Yuhao and nodded slightly to indicate to Huo Yuhao.

Huo Yuhao had no intention of hiding it. As the three of them turned their gazes to him, he said with a wry smile, "That student is me."

The two deans, who had anticipated this, froze for a moment. They coughed twice, and Xian Lin'er said awkwardly, "I forgot to introduce you. Fan Yu, this is my new disciple, Huo Yuhao. He's also the adopted son the vice dean and I just adopted. I haven't had time to introduce him to you yet."

Fan Yu's eyes flashed with surprise, and he couldn't help but feel speechless. Zhou Yi really could cause him trouble. He originally thought she was just a disciple, and now she's his adopted son, a close relationship. You've directly helped me offend my two bosses. You're really amazing.
Fortunately, he knew that both deans were good people. He had come to apologize on his own initiative, and since the matter hadn't even been brought to Huo Yuhao's attention, it was relatively easy to resolve. If he had been a few steps later, Huo Yuhao would have complained first and then added fuel to the fire.
Fan Yu was also very good at dealing with people. He smiled and congratulated the two deans, "Fan Yu, congratulations to the two deans on adopting such a talented, intelligent, and well-educated son. I just made this seventh-level flying soul guide. Yu Hao is now at the Soul Master level, and this flying soul guide is just what he needs. I'll give it to the child as an apology on behalf of my daughter Zhou Yi."

As he spoke, Fan Yu pulled out a light blue, translucent, cicada-wing-shaped flying soul device from his collection. He slowly walked over to Huo Yuhao and handed it to him, saying somewhat helplessly, "I know Zhou Yi's character. Yuhao, I'm sorry you've been wronged by this matter. I apologize on her behalf. Please accept it. I haven't chosen a name for it yet, so you can choose one yourself."

Huo Yuhao knew that accepting this apology would completely wipe the slate clean. He looked Fan Yu in the eye and nodded gently, "Thank you for your gift. I like it very much. Teacher Fan Yu, please help me with any academic questions I may have in the future."

Fan Yu breathed a sigh of relief, the matter was finally over.

He nodded slightly to the two deans and said, "Then I'll take my leave first. Goodbye, deans and Yuhao." After that, he slowly walked out of the experimental area.

Xian Lin'er and Qian Duoduo waited until the door closed before looking at Huo Yuhao. Xian Lin'er gently pinched Huo Yuhao's face and said, "You little rascal, you didn't even tell us about such a big thing! If you dare to hide it from me again, you'll have a few more bricks as homework!"

Huo Yuhao scratched his head a little embarrassedly and said, "Haven't I found the chance to tell you yet?"

Qian Duoduo patted Huo Yuhao on the back and said, "Fan Yu is quite sensible. You can always go to him if you have any questions in the future. When it comes to talent in soul guides, Lin'er and I are far behind him. If anyone in Shrek has the best chance of becoming a ninth-level soul guide, it's probably Fan Yu. Let's go home and have dinner first."
